Nestled on the rugged slopes of Mount Parnitha, Greece's closest national park to Athens at just 30 kilometers from the city center, the Parnitha Cave Network reveals a labyrinth of ancient worship sites carved into dramatic gorges and limestone cliffs. This interconnected system centers on cult caves dedicated to Pan, the nymphs, and Zeus, blending Mycenaean-era sanctuaries with Byzantine hermitages amid pine forests and wild rivers like the Keladonas. Spring (March-May) and autumn (September-November) offer ideal conditions with mild weather, blooming wildflowers, and low crowds, avoiding summer heat and winter snow.

Treks to the iconic Cave of Pan in Goura Gorge, ancient hub for the goat-god's rituals with 2,000 oil lamps unearthed, deliver immersive access to Greece's premier Pan worship site. Trails from Kliston Monastery wind through pine-clad peaks to this nymph-guarded cavern.
Loop hikes starting at this 10th-century Byzantine site link to Pan's Cave and Arma via well-signed 9km paths with 500m elevation, showcasing monastic ruins fused with pagan cave altars.
Descend the wild Keladonas river gorge to Pan's Cave and nearby abysses, where Bronze Age artifacts and speleology reveal Parnitha's role as Attica's fortified spiritual heartland.
Guided visits to Phyle Cave, alias Lychnospilia, highlight thousands of ancient lamps from Pan and nymph cults, unique to Parnitha's pre-Christian devotion in Athens' backyard.
Follow the Mycenaean-era Arma path from Kiafa Marista peak to Pan's Cave, climbing pine slopes for 3.5km each way with 500m gain, evoking ancient shepherds' pilgrimages.
Ascend to Parnitha's 1,413m summit cave, a 2.5x5m Zeus shrine amid red deer habitats, tying into the mountain's pantheon of high-altitude divine grottos.
